Learn about CVE-2023-48294 affecting LibreNMS, allowing unauthorized users to access sensitive network information. Find mitigation steps and how to prevent exploitation.
LibreNMS is an auto-discovering PHP/MySQL/SNMP based network monitoring tool. The CVE-2023-48294 highlights a 'Broken Access Control' vulnerability on the Graphs Feature in LibreNMS.
Understanding CVE-2023-48294
This section will provide insights into the vulnerability, its impact, technical details, and mitigation steps.
What is CVE-2023-48294?
The vulnerability in LibreNMS allows low privilege users to access sensitive information by exploiting the 'graph.php' feature. By sending requests to this endpoint, unauthorized actors can enumerate devices and view admin user registrations.
The Impact of CVE-2023-48294
The impact of this vulnerability can lead to exposure of sensitive information, compromising the confidentiality of network data. It affects LibreNMS versions prior to 23.11.0, putting network security at risk.
Technical Details of CVE-2023-48294
Understanding the vulnerability in-depth is crucial to implement effective mitigation strategies.
Vulnerability Description
A low privilege user can exploit 'graph.php' to access device graphs and gather information on all registered devices, breaching access control mechanisms within LibreNMS.
Affected Systems and Versions
LibreNMS versions older than 23.11.0 are vulnerable to this exploit, allowing unauthorized users to view sensitive network information.
Exploitation Mechanism
By manipulating requests to 'graph.php,' malicious actors can access device data, potentially compromising network security and exposing confidential information.
Mitigation and Prevention
Protecting systems from CVE-2023-48294 requires immediate actions and long-term security measures.
Immediate Steps to Take
Users are strongly advised to upgrade LibreNMS to version 23.11.0 or newer to patch the vulnerability. Regularly monitor access controls and user privileges to prevent unauthorized data access.
Long-Term Security Practices
Implement strict access controls, conduct regular security audits, and educate users on safe data handling practices to enhance network security.
Patching and Updates
Frequent updates and patch management are essential to address security vulnerabilities promptly and ensure the integrity of network monitoring systems.